Page 785 - (4) The term 'period of war* means the Mexican border period, World War I, World War II, the Korean conflict, the Vietnam era, and the period beginning on the date of any future declaration of war by the Congress and ending on the date prescribed by Presidential proclamation or concurrent resolution of the Congress.
